Is East Salem a Good Place to Live?
Economy & Jobs
East Salem residents earn a median household income of $68,333 , which is 9% below the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$26,719. The unemployment rate stands at 1.2% (67%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 15.8%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 581 business establishments, including 32 restaurants.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in East Salem is $156,300 , 45%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$220,682. Median rent is $1,075/month, with 22.9%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 97.6 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1952.
Safety & Crime
East Salem reports 0 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 100%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 2,164/100K.
Education
13.5% of adults in East Salem hold a bachelor's degree or higher (60% below the national average). 95.9% have completed high school. Local schools score 5.5/10 in standardized testing.
Climate & Weather
East Salem has an average annual temperature of 52°F (11°C). Winters average 28°F in January while summers reach 74°F in July. The area gets 282 sunny days per year.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 40.
